A Level 2 Electrician isn't your everyday sparky. While a general electrician may manage internal electrical wiring, lighting setups, and power point repair work, the Level 2 professional operates on a different aircraft, authorised to work straight on the service network facilities. This consists of overhead and underground service lines, metering equipment, and the important connections that bring power from the street to a consumer's premises. They are the ones you call when your service fuse blows, when you need a new power pole installed, or when you're upgrading your switchboard to manage increased power needs. Their work is often performed at height, underground, or in close proximity to live wires, requiring a severe awareness of threat and a careful adherence to security procedures.
The journey to ending up being a Level 2 Electrician is a difficult but gratifying one, demanding substantial devotion. It typically starts with website completing a Certificate III in Electrotechnology Electrician, followed by numerous years of useful experience as a qualified electrician. This foundational understanding then paves the way for specialised training and evaluation that covers the particular subtleties of dealing with the service network. Aspiring Level 2 professionals must show proficiency in areas such as overhead service work, underground service work, metering, and disconnections/reconnections. This extensive training guarantees they possess the needed proficiency to handle intricate scenarios securely and efficiently, often involving live electrical components where a single misstep could have serious effects.
Their competence reaches a broad variety of vital services. When a brand-new dwelling is constructed, it's the Level 2 Electrician who links it to the mains power supply, installing the meter and ensuring all required security checks are performed. Similarly, if a residential or commercial property undergoes considerable remodelling or requires an upgrade to its electrical capability, these are the specialists who evaluate the existing infrastructure, carry out the needed upgrades to theboard, and ensure the whole system can safely handle the increased load. They are likewise important in emergency situation scenarios, reacting to power outages, fixing storm-damaged lines, and correcting concerns that compromise the stability of the power supply. Their swift and decisive actions in these situations are vital in bring back power and minimising disruption for locals and companies.
